Questions & Answers
The cheapest way to get from Santa Fe to Iguazu Falls is to bus which costs $75000 - $120000 and takes 17h 10m.
The fastest way to get from Santa Fe to Iguazu Falls is to fly which takes 4h 58m and costs $380000 - $750000.
No, there is no direct bus from Santa Fe to Iguazu Falls. However, there are services departing from Terminal de Santa Fe Gral. Belgrano and arriving at Cataratas Argentinas via Puerto Libertad and Terminal de Ómnibus de Puerto Iguazú.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 16h 25m.
The distance between Santa Fe and Iguazu Falls is 939 km. The road distance is 1048.7 km.
